Journal of Babol University of Medical Sciences

Majallah-i dānishgāh-i ̒ulūm-i pizishkī-i Bābul

مجله علمی دانشگاه علوم پزشکی بابل

Abbreviation: J. Babol Univ. Med. Sci.

Published by: Babol University of Medical Sciences

Publisher Location: Babol, Iran (Islamic Republic of)

Range of citations in the SafetyLit database: 2020; 22(1) -- 2021; 23(1)

Publication Date Range: 1998 --

Title began with volume (issue): 1(1)

pISSN = 1561-4107 | eISSN = 2251-7170
OCLC = 1058373858


Find a library that holds this journal: http://worldcat.org/issn/15614107

Journal Language(s): Persian, English

Articles published from 2015 forward are available in the English language

Monthly from 2013. From 2019 in "continuous" format: Updated in SafetyLit bi-monthly.


Aims and Scope (from publisher): Journal of Babol University of Medical Sciences is an international open-access peer-reviewed bilingual (English and Persian) journal devoted to the field of Multi-disciplinary Medical, Health, Traditional medicine, and General medical fields. It is a scientific publication of Babol University of Medical Sciences. It is an interdisciplinary journal devoted to the publication of original articles, review articles, etc., considering the research ethics and academic rules and regulations.
